怎么把Windows 11的“在终端中打开”添加到右键菜单【开发者】
发布时间:2026-01-02 00:00
发布者:幻夢星雲
浏览次数:需启用开发者模式并修改注册表或运行PowerShell脚本,在文件资源管理器右键菜单的【开发者】分组中添加“在终端中打开”选项,命令调用wt.exe并传入当前路径。
如果您希望在Windows 11的文件资源管理器右键菜单中添加“在终端中打开”选项,并将其归类至【开发者】分组,需通过修改注册表或使用PowerShell脚本注入对应项。以下是实现该功能的具体步骤:
一、通过注册表手动添加
此方法直接编辑注册表,在“计算机\HKEY_CLASSES_ROOT\Directory\Background\shell”路径下创建新项,使右键菜单显示“在终端中打开”,并归属【开发者】上下文分组。
1、按 Win + R 打开运行窗口,输入 regedit 并回车,以管理员身份运行注册表编辑器。
2、导航至路径:计算机\HKEY_CLASSES_ROOT\Directory\Background\shell。
3、在 shell 项上右键 → “新建” → “项”,命名为 WindowsTerminal。
4、选中新建的 WindowsTerminal 项,在右侧空白处右键 → “新建” → “字符串值”,名称设为 MUIVerb,双击编辑其数值数据为 在终端中打开。
5、在同一项下再新建一个字符串值,名称为 Icon,数值数据填写:C:\Users\%USERNAME%\AppData\Local\Microsoft\WindowsApps\wt.exe(若路径不存在,可留空或使用 wt.exe 的实际安装路径)。
6、再次右键 WindowsTerminal → “新建” → “项”,命名为 command。
7、选中 command 项,在右侧默认字符串值中双击,输入以下命令:
C:\Users\%USERNAME%\AppData\Local\Microsoft\WindowsApps\wt.exe -d "%V"
8、返回 WindowsTerminal 项,右键 → “新建” → “字符串值”,命名为 Group,数值数据设为 Developer。
二、使用PowerShell脚本一键部署
此方法通过执行预置PowerShell脚本自动创建注册表项,避免手动操作错误,并确保“开发者”分组标识正确写入。
1、以管理员身份打开 PowerShell(开始菜单搜索 PowerShell → 右键选择“以管理员身份运行”)。
2、复制并粘贴以下完整脚本后回车执行:
New-Item -Path "HKCR:\Directory\Background\shell\WindowsTerminal" -Force
Set-ItemProperty -Path "HKCR:\Directory\Background\shell\WindowsTerminal" -Name "MUIVerb" -Value "在终端中打开"
Set-ItemProperty -Path "HKCR:\Directory\Background\shell\WindowsTerminal" -Name "Icon" -Value "$env:LOCALAPPDATA\Packages\Microsoft.WindowsTerminal_8wekyb3d8bbwe\LocalState\wt.exe"
Set-ItemProperty -Path "HKCR:\Directory\Background\shell\WindowsTerminal" -Name "Group" -Value "Developer"
New-Item -Path "HKCR:\Directory\Background\shell\WindowsTerminal\command" -Force
Set-ItemProperty -Path "HKCR:\Directory\Background\shell\WindowsTerminal\command" -Name "(Default)" -Value 'C:\Users\%USERNAME%\AppData\Local\Microsoft\WindowsApps\wt.exe -d "%V"'
三、启用开发者模式后验证分组显示
Windows 11需启用开发者模式,系统才会识别并渲染“Group=Developer”所指定的上下文分组,否则该条目可能出现在常规右键区域而非【开发者】子菜单中。
1、打开“设置” → “系统” → “对于开发人员”。
2、在右侧开启 开发者模式 开关,并等待系统完成配置(可能需要
数分钟及重启资源管理器)。
3、按 Ctrl + Shift + Esc 打开任务管理器 → “详细信息”选项卡 → 找到 explorer.exe → 右键选择“结束任务”。
4、点击“文件” → “运行新任务”,输入 explorer.exe 并勾选“以系统管理权限创建此任务”,然后回车。
5、在任意文件夹空白处右键,确认出现【开发者】分组,且其中包含 在终端中打开 选项。
# default
# 如果您
# 空白处
# 修改注册表
# 右键菜单
# 双击
# 设为
# 字符串值
# 命名为
# 右键
# background
# windows
# 字符串
# Directory
# shell脚本
# windows 11
# microsoft
# win
# 资源管理器
# 注册表
# app
# 计算机
相关文章:
如何在Golang中添加第三方包_Golanggo get包安装与版本控制
HTML透明颜色代码在Angular里怎么设置_Angular透明颜色使用指南【详解】
Claude如何关闭自动续费_Claude续费关闭方法【方法】
快手官方网站登录入口 快手网页版官方入口
外媒谈《仙剑奇侠传四:重制版》"类33号远征队":许多现代RPG相互影响
Java里注释有哪几种写法_Java代码注释规范说明
原神千雪度假村网页活动怎么玩-原神千雪度假村网页活动玩法
智能客服小程序,中小商家值得布局吗?
html5 plus怎么调用_HTML5 Plus在HBuilder中调用扫码拍照等原生API【调用】
ArchiveofOurOwn国内访问指南 2026年稳定镜像节点汇总
如何正确启动 JProfiler(Linux 环境下常见误用解析)
如何使用Golang net包进行TCP通信_Golang net TCP客户端与服务器示例
Python配置文件加载_多环境适配解析【教程】
安克发布新款氮化镓充电宝:体积缩小 30%,支持 200W 输出
Python面向对象测试方法_mock解析【教程】
Python闭包与作用域详解教程_变量捕获与实践案例
HTML5空格在Angular项目里怎么处理_Angular中空格的渲染问题【详解】
Mac如何快速锁定屏幕?(多种快捷方式)
如何在Golang中实现基础API限流功能_Golang请求频率控制与处理示例
如何在 Go 中使用 Redigo 将结构体数组存入并从 Redis 读取
最强祖师龙傲天四阶法宝锻造及本命养成
Java中如何对对象数组使用Stream API进行过滤操作
ChatGPT回答中断怎么办 引导AI继续输出完整内容的方法
css响应式断点该如何选择_基于常见设备宽度设置区间
如何使用Golang实现条件短路_Golang逻辑运算优化技巧
光遇办公室圣诞节物品在哪兑换-光遇办公室圣诞节物品兑换方法
Mac如何修复应用程序权限问题_Mac磁盘工具修复权限【教程】
悟空识字如何进行跟读录音_悟空识字开启麦克风权限与录音
css 页面加载动画怎么实现_利用 css animation 制作加载效果
如何在嵌套树形结构中递归查找指定 slug 的节点及其完整子树
相关栏目:
【
行业资讯17850 】
【
软件资源51899 】
【
网站技术89748 】
【
百度推广44206 】
【
网络营销84187 】
【
运营推广93002 】
【
AI优化91086 】
【
网络优化117696 】
【
网址导航107142 】






